Let’s start with the honest maths, because that is the only place a sensible gambler ever starts. If you deposit £50 at a PayPal casino and claim a 100% match bonus, you are playing with £100. But that bonus will almost certainly carry wagering requirements – say 35x. That means you must wager £3,500 before you can withdraw a penny of the bonus winnings. The house edge on a typical online slot sits around 3% to 5%, so the expected loss on that £3,500 turnover is somewhere between £105 and £175. In other words, the bonus is not free money; it is a loan of entertainment with a heavy interest charge. The wise approach is to treat any bonus as a chance to extend your play, not as a path to guaranteed profit. How PayPal Deposits Work: Step by Step

PayPal remains one of the most trusted names in online payments, and its presence at UK-licensed casinos is widespread. The process of funding your account is straightforward, but there are a few nuances worth understanding before you click that deposit button.

When you choose PayPal as your deposit method, you are effectively authorising the casino to request a payment from your PayPal balance, linked bank account, or linked debit card. The money moves almost instantly – we are talking seconds, not minutes. There is no need to enter your card details on the casino site, which is a genuine security benefit. You log into PayPal, confirm the payment, and the funds appear in your casino balance immediately.

Here is the step-by-step breakdown of how a typical PayPal deposit flows:

Step What Happens Time Required
1. Choose PayPal at the cashier Select PayPal from the deposit options and enter your chosen amount Seconds
2. Redirect to PayPal You are taken to PayPal’s secure login page; the casino never sees your password Seconds
3. Confirm the payment Review the amount and confirm; you may need to approve via the PayPal app on your phone Seconds
4. Funds credited Your casino balance updates instantly and you are ready to spin Instant

The whole process takes less than a minute. One important detail: if your PayPal account is linked to a credit card, some casinos may treat that deposit differently for bonus purposes. Since April 2020, using a credit card for gambling in Great Britain has been banned outright, so PayPal will only ever draw from your balance, a debit card, or a bank account. That ban applies to the payment method itself, and PayPal enforces it on their side too.

Fees, Limits and Processing Times: The Precise Picture

Let’s talk money movement in both directions. The good news is that PayPal deposits to UK casinos are free for the player. The casino absorbs the merchant fees, which typically run around 2% to 3% of the transaction. You will not see a surcharge at the cashier, and that is a consistent feature across the licensed operators we cover.

Withdrawals are where things get slightly more interesting. Most PayPal casinos do not charge a withdrawal fee, but a small number may apply a charge after a certain number of free withdrawals per month. That is a commercial decision by the operator, not a PayPal policy, so it always pays to check the cashier’s terms. PayPal themselves do not charge you for receiving funds from a casino.

Deposit limits vary by operator, but a typical minimum is £10, with maximums often set between £5,000 and £10,000 per transaction. Withdrawal minimums are usually the same £10, while maximums can range from £1,000 per transaction to £10,000 or more, depending on your verification status and the operator’s tiering.

Processing times are where PayPal shines. Deposits are instant, as we have covered. Withdrawals are processed by the casino within their standard timeframe – typically 0 to 24 hours for approval – and then PayPal transfers the funds to your account almost immediately. In practice, a withdrawal request made on a weekday morning can land in your PayPal balance within a few hours. Bonus Eligibility: The E-Wallet Exclusion Trap

Here is the nuance that catches many players out. Some casinos exclude e-wallet deposits – including PayPal – from bonus eligibility. The logic is simple: e-wallets make it too easy to launder money through bonus cycles, so operators restrict them to reduce fraud risk. If a bonus says “deposit with a card to qualify”, then a PayPal deposit will not trigger the offer.

That said, the landscape is far from uniform. Many UK-licensed casinos now include PayPal in their bonus eligibility, recognising that players prefer the convenience and security it offers. The key is to read the bonus terms before you deposit. Look for the phrase “payment method exclusions” in the wagering requirements. If PayPal is listed as excluded, you have two choices: use a different method for the bonus, or skip the bonus and play with your own funds.

When a bonus is available on PayPal deposits, the wagering requirements typically fall in the 20x to 65x range. For example, a £50 bonus at 40x would require £2,000 of turnover. Always multiply the bonus amount by the wagering requirement to understand the true cost of the offer. Security and Buyer Protection: The Honest Reality

PayPal is often marketed as offering buyer protection, and that is true for physical goods. But gambling transactions are explicitly carved out of PayPal’s buyer protection policy. You cannot dispute a lost bet and expect a refund. If you deposit £100 and lose it at the tables, that is the end of the matter. PayPal will not mediate on your behalf.

What PayPal does offer is a layer of financial insulation. The casino never sees your bank account or card details, which reduces the risk of your financial information being compromised in a data breach. PayPal also uses strong encryption and two-factor authentication, making unauthorised access significantly harder.

For dispute resolution, your real protection comes from the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C). All licensed operators must have a complaints procedure, and if that fails, you can escalate to an independent alternative dispute resolution (ADR) service. PayPal’s role is purely as a payment rail; it does not arbitrate gambling disputes. Understanding this distinction is crucial for managing your expectations.

PayPal vs the Alternatives: A Fair Comparison

PayPal is excellent, but it is not always the best choice. Let’s compare it fairly against the other main options available to UK players. This comparison uses typical figures across the market; individual operators may vary.

Method Deposit Speed Withdrawal Speed Typical Limits Bonus Friendly? Best For
PayPal Instant Under 24 hours £10 – £10,000 Sometimes Fast payouts and security
Debit Card Instant 1–3 days £10 – £50,000 Usually yes Bonus hunters
Skrill Instant Under 24 hours £10 – £10,000 Sometimes E-wallet users seeking alternatives
Bank Transfer 1–3 hours 2–5 days £20 – unlimited Often yes High rollers

As the table shows, PayPal and Skrill are very similar in speed. The differentiator is usually bonus eligibility and personal preference. The Withdrawal Flow: Verification and Timelines

Before you can withdraw to PayPal, you will need to complete the casino’s verification process. This is a UKGC requirement, not an optional extra. You will need to provide proof of identity – typically a passport or driving licence – and proof of address, such as a recent utility bill or bank statement. Some operators also request a selfie holding your ID for an extra layer of security.

Verification can take anywhere from a few minutes to 48 hours. If you upload clear, well-lit documents, the process is usually swift. The smart move is to verify your account immediately after registering, before you even make your first deposit. That way, when you request a withdrawal, there is no delay.

The withdrawal flow itself is simple. Request the withdrawal via the cashier, select PayPal as your method, and enter the amount. The casino will review the request – this is the “pending” period, typically 0 to 24 hours. Once approved, the funds are sent to your PayPal account, where they appear almost instantly. You can then transfer them to your bank account or spend them as you wish.

One practical tip: some casinos require you to have deposited via PayPal at least once before allowing a PayPal withdrawal. This is an anti-money-laundering measure designed to ensure funds return to their source. If you deposited via card but try to withdraw via PayPal, the request may be rejected. Always match your withdrawal method to a previously used deposit method where possible.

Before You Claim: A Safer Gambling Reminder

Gambling should always be a form of entertainment, never a way to make money or solve financial problems. Every game carries a house edge, which means the odds are stacked against you over time. Set a budget you can comfortably afford to lose, and stick to it. Never chase losses, and never gamble with money earmarked for bills or essentials. If you feel your gambling is slipping out of control, free help is available. GAMSTOP (gamstop.co.uk) is the national self-exclusion scheme that blocks you from all UK-licensed sites, and GambleAware offers confidential support and advice. All gambling products are strictly 18+.

Quickfire Answers

How do I withdraw my winnings back to the same PayPal account I deposited from?

Simply select PayPal as your withdrawal method in the cashier and enter the amount. The casino will send the funds to the same PayPal email address you used for the deposit. The request is usually approved within 24 hours, and the money appears in your PayPal balance almost immediately after approval. Just make sure you have completed identity verification beforehand to avoid any delay.

What fees should I expect when using PayPal at a UK casino?

Deposits are free, and PayPal does not charge you for receiving casino withdrawals. Some operators may apply a withdrawal fee after a certain number of free transactions per month, but this is their commercial choice, not PayPal’s policy. Check the cashier’s terms to confirm the current fee structure before you request a payout.

When does a PayPal deposit fail to qualify for a welcome bonus?

Some casinos exclude e-wallets, including PayPal, from bonus eligibility to reduce fraud risk. If the bonus terms list PayPal as an excluded payment method, your deposit will not trigger the offer. The solution is to use a debit card for the bonus deposit, or to play without the bonus using PayPal funds. Always read the wagering requirements section before depositing.
